Recognizing Fake Cash Offers and Advance Fee Schemes

Recognizing fake cash offers and advance fee schemes is essential for homeowners in Akron to protect themselves during a real estate transaction. Scammers may present seemingly attractive cash offers that require upfront fees for services like title searches, claiming these are necessary to facilitate the sale. Homeowners should be cautious and verify the legitimacy of any financial transaction, especially if it involves unexpected costs or pressure to act quickly, as these tactics often lead to foreclosure or loss of property.

Demands for Upfront Fees or Personal Information

Homeowners in Akron should be wary of any cash home buyer who demands upfront fees or personal information before proceeding with a sale. Legitimate buyers typically do not require payment for services like appraisals or title searches until after an agreement is reached. If a buyer pressures sellers for immediate payment or sensitive information, it is a strong indicator of a potential scam, and sellers should take the time to verify the buyer’s credentials and legitimacy before moving forward.

Confirming Licensing With Ohio Real Estate Authorities

Confirming licensing with Ohio real estate authorities is a vital step for homeowners in Akron to ensure they are dealing with legitimate cash home buyers. Homeowners can verify a buyer’s credentials by checking the Ohio Division of Real Estate and Professional Licensing website, which provides a list of licensed real estate professionals. This simple action can help prevent potential scams and protect homeowners from fraudulent transactions, ensuring peace of mind during the selling process:

StepDescription
Visit the Ohio Division of Real Estate WebsiteAccess the official site to find licensed real estate professionals.
Search for Buyer CredentialsUse the search function to verify the buyer's license status.
Check for ComplaintsLook for any reported issues or complaints against the buyer.
Contact Authorities if NecessaryReach out to the Ohio Division for further verification if needed.

Using Secure Payment and Escrow Services

Using secure payment and escrow services is vital for homeowners in Akron looking to sell their homes for cash safely. These services act as intermediaries, ensuring that funds are securely held until all terms of the sale are met, which protects both the seller and the buyer. By utilizing reputable escrow companies, sellers can mitigate the risk of fraud and ensure a smooth transaction process, providing peace of mind during the sale.
